Giovanni Francesco Straparola
Summary
Giovanni Francesco Straparola is a human[1]. His place of birth was Caravaggio[2]. He was born on +1480-01-01T00:00:00Z[3]. He passed away in Venice[4]. He worked as a writer[5], children's writer[6], and collector of fairy tales[7]. He ranks in the top 0.72% of human entities by monthly Wikipedia readership (58 views/month, #7,251 of 1,000,298).[8]
